My Background and Approach
My therapeutic approach blends humanistic and psychodynamic principles, complemented by DBT and CBT for coping mechanisms. I believe that many of our behaviors and internal beliefs derive from our childhood experiences. A combination of humanistic and psychodynamic therapy allows clients to recognize the power within themselves, explore how their past has influenced their current behavior and thought patterns, and use their inherent abilities from within to heal and navigate life in a direction that provides a deeper sense of meaning and fulfillment.
